Easy to store

You can exercise at home when it's too cold or rainy to go outside. It is important to know the right way to choose one that suits your needs. Take into consideration features like dimensions, weight capacity, and incline capability. You should also look into the treadmill's folding and unfolding mechanism to see whether it's simple to use. Many treadmills that fold use gas shocks to help them lower slowly and safely to the floor when folded. A treadmill without this feature could slam down to the floor when you release it and can cause damage to your furniture or floors.

The good thing is that today's treadmills that fold can be just as durable and long-lasting as their non-folding counterparts. It is still important to research the specifications of a treadmill and measure the space you're planning to put it in your home. This will prevent you from purchasing a treadmill that is too big for your home, making it difficult to get the most out of your exercise.

A treadmill that has an safety feature that shuts the machine off when you quit using it is a further option to consider. This is a great feature particularly if your home is home to pets or children. It is also possible to find a treadmill with multiple safety features, including a digital speed and incline display.

Foldable treadmills are great for saving space in your home. However, it is important to keep in mind that folding mechanism introduces additional moving parts that could get worn out over time. Some people might consider this to be a problem since they prefer the stability and durability of models that do not fold.

Easy to assemble

A treadmill is an excellent way to burn calories and tone your muscles. However they can be heavy and hard to store in apartments or homes with limited space. The good news is that there are a few kinds of foldable treadmills on the market that can aid in making incorporating exercise into your daily routine much easier and more practical.

When selecting a treadmill that folds, the first thing you should think about is how it is simple to set up and fold. You can select an adjustable treadmill that has a hinge-like system, where the deck folds inwards and joins the console mast. This design is easy to use and requires less space than a traditional treadmill. It's also a great option for those who have little storage space.

In addition to the ease of assembly, you must take into consideration the durability and stability your folding treadmill. Many people are worried that a model that folds is less durable or stable than its non-folding counterpart, but this isn't always the case. Manufacturers have made a lot of improvements to the stability and endurance of treadmills that fold over the decades, and the current models are as durable as their non-folding counterparts.

If you're looking for a folding machine, it's important to also be aware of its weight and dimensions. Some folding treadmills can be very heavy and may require assistance in moving them. Others are smaller and can be easily rolled into a corner or closet when not being used.

It is crucial to keep in mind that even a folding machine needs regular maintenance. In addition to maintaining the belt's lubrication and examining the motor, you should clean the machine regularly to prevent dust accumulation. It is recommended to use a special treadmill cleaner and wipe down the treadmill after every exercise. Keep your treadmill clean to extend its life and improve performance. It also lowers the chance of getting injured. Online, you can find various treadmill cleaners.

Motor with power

Treadmills can be an excellent way to exercise at home. However, they are heavy and take up a lot of space. Some people choose to purchase an adjustable machine that folds. These machines are easy to store and can provide a safe and effective exercise. They can help you shed weight and feel healthier overall.

When selecting a treadmill with a folding design, consider the weight capacity and maximum speed. Many of these machines can hold runners up to 275 pounds and can reach speeds of up to 10 mph. They also come with an auto-incline feature which lets you adjust the incline during your workout. This can help you target certain areas of your body and build to a thumping sweat in no time.

The best folding treadmills are equipped with an efficient motor that can take on the demands of running or walking at full incline. They are fitted with a safety clamp that will stop the belt from moving in case it is ever tripped. There are a variety of monitors which show your heart rate, distance, and other vital data. Some of them have Bluetooth integrated, which allows you to connect your smartphone or tablet to stream music or podcasts while working out.

Take into consideration the weight of the treadmill and how much room it will require when folded. Some models are hard to fold and unfold, and may require two people to accomplish the task. Others come with a lock latch that must be activated before the deck can be folded which is why you must make sure that it is securely locked prior to cleaning or moving the machine.

Some treadmills that fold come with a gas-shock that lowers the deck slowly and gently to the ground upon release. This is a major advantage if you have pets or children in the home. This feature could also save your time and money since you don't have to spend money on a repair in the event that the deck is damaged.

Another thing to think about is whether you'll be using the treadmill in a room with other equipment or furniture. If so, you should look for a model with adjustable incline and speed settings that are able to meet your needs. It's also an excellent idea to search for one that has various workout programs that are preset which include interval training.

Warranty

A high-quality treadmill comes with an extended warranty covering the frame, motor and the running belt. This warranty should be offered without cost and cover the entire lifetime of the treadmill. You may also want to look into buying an extended protection plan for your treadmill folding treadmills for home that will allow you to find a replacement in the case of a manufacturing defect or damage.

You should also consider purchasing a folding device that has a lifetime warranty on the frame and motor. This type of warranty ensures that you receive a product that is high-quality and will last for many years. But, be sure to review the fine print if there are any limitations.

Another important factor to look for is the dimensions of the deck as well as the motor horsepower. A walking treadmill with an engine horsepower of 2.0-2.5 is sufficient for most people. Professional runners will require a treadmill with more power.

The first thing to keep in mind when purchasing a treadmill that folds is that you should always read the manual before using it. This will provide you with an understanding of the treadmill's features and will allow you to get the most value from it. Then, you can utilize the treadmill in a safe and efficient manner.

Find out if there are handrails on the treadmill. They can help those with limited mobility to improve their balance and comfort when exercising. Handrails are also helpful for users that have difficulty getting on or off of the treadmill. In addition, you must verify the weight capacity of the treadmill before making a purchase. A higher weight capacity indicates that the treadmill that folds up is more durable and is able to accommodate the weight of a larger person.

In the end, you must determine whether the treadmill has gas shock. This will allow the treadmill that folds up to fold and unfold more gently and is great for safety. If a treadmill doesn't have a gas shock it will crash on the ground if released, which can hurt the paws and hands of children. Avoid treadmills that have side handles.
